Harman International Industries, part of Samsung Electronics, designs and manufactures premium audio, infotainment, and connected‑car solutions for consumer and enterprise markets. The company’s product lines—ranging from high‑end speakers to in‑vehicle entertainment systems—are widely used by automotive OEMs and consumer electronics brands worldwide. Harman’s hiring pipeline covers a spectrum of tech roles: embedded and firmware engineers, audio signal processing specialists, software developers for Android Automotive and connected‑car platforms, UX/UI designers, data scientists, and system integration engineers. Non‑tech positions include supply‑chain analysts, product marketers, and business‑development managers. Applicants can expect structured interview stages that test domain knowledge, problem‑solving skills, and cross‑functional collaboration. Teams often work on co‑development projects with automotive partners, providing exposure to both hardware and software ecosystems.
